Andrew Tate has posted a "pain" message on social media after losing his appeal against being detained for 30 days in Romania.

Tate yesterday lost his appeal against the 30-day detainment, and Tate has now issued his first response online. He tweeted: "When Allah said ‘I test only those I love.’ I took the pain like it was an honour - Abu Hurayrah." Throughout the case, the Tate brothers have denied any wrongdoing and have regularly challenged the arrest warrant via their appointed lawyer Eugen Vidineac. The Tate siblings were pictured with authorities in handcuffs, with prosecutors insisting they are granted further detention for 180 days while they continue to explore the alleged charges.

In a message posted on Twitter, Mr Vidineac wrote: "Even up to the present moment, the criminal investigation file has not been made available to us to ensure the effective defence of our clients. In this sense, I would like to point out, at least from this point of view, I am also somehow amazed, there is not a single piece of evidence apart from the victim's statement that leads to the idea that a crime of rape was committed.
